Christmas Breakfast Bake

Here is another quick and simple breakfast casserole recipe, much like Farmer's Breakfast Casserole.  It is perfect for a relaxing Christmas brunch, or anytime you need a breakfast casserole for guests.  We received this recipe from a friend at our church, and anytime she makes it for church conferences it is a huge hit!

Ingredients

1 pkg. (about 2 lbs) Potatoes O'Brien - the chunk kind
2 cups ham, bacon, or sausage, browned
1 cup grated cheese
1 dozen eggs
1 cup milk (you can also use cream to make it creamier)
1/2 tsp. salt and pepper

Directions

Mix together eggs and milk.
Add hash browns, cheese, and browned meat.
Pour into a buttered 9x13 pan.
Top with 1/4 cup more grated cheese and sprinkle with parsley flakes if desired.
Bake at 350 degrees for 30 minutes (could take up to 45 minutes if potatoes are slightly frozen).
